1 A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
2 AN ACT TO ENSURE ACADEMIC TRANSPARENCY.
3 The General Assembly of North Carolina enacts:
4 SECTION 1. Article 8 of Chapter 115C of the General Statutes is amended by adding
5 a new section to read:
6 "§ 115C-98A. Inform the public about instructional materials.
7 (a) The governing body of a public school unit shall ensure that the following information
8 for each school it governs is prominently displayed on the school website by July 1 of each year,
9 organized, at a minimum, by subject area and grade level:
10 (1) The instructional materials and activities that were used at the school during
11 the prior school year, including all of the following:
12 a. Anything assigned, distributed, or otherwise presented in any course
13 for which a student receives credit.
14 b. Any materials from among which students are required to select one
15 or more if the selection is restricted by the school.
16 (2) Any procedures for the documentation, review, or approval of the learning
17 materials used for student instruction at the school, including by the principal,
18 curriculum administrators, or other teachers.
19 (b) The information displayed shall include the information necessary to identify the
20 learning materials and activities used for instruction, including the title and the author,
21 organization, or website associated with each material and activity. Nothing in this section shall
22 be construed to require the digital reproduction of the materials themselves or the separate
23 reporting of individual components of materials produced as a single volume.
24 (c) A governing body that is responsible for the operation of schools with fewer than 500
25 students cumulatively is not required to comply with the requirements of this section.
26 (d) The following definitions apply in this section:
27 (1) Activities. – Any instructional task, including, but not limited to,
28 presentations, assemblies, lectures, or other activities or events facilitated by
29 the school, excluding student presentations.
30 (2) Instructional materials. – Any material used for instruction, including, but not
31 limited to, all textbooks, other reading materials, videos, digital materials,
32 websites, and other online applications."
33 SECTION 2. G.S. 115C-12 is amended by adding a new subdivision to read:
34 "(9e) Duty to Inform the Public About Instructional Materials. – The Board shall
35 ensure that information about instructional materials for any school operated

1 under Article 7A and Article 9C of this Chapter is prominently displayed on
2 the website of the school, as required by G.S. 115C-98A."
3 SECTION 3. G.S. 115C-47 is amended by adding a new subdivision to read:
4 "(58a) To Inform the Public About Instructional Materials. – Local boards of
5 education shall ensure that information about instructional materials for each
6 school in the local school administrative unit is prominently displayed on the
7 website of the school, as required by G.S. 115C-98A."
8 SECTION 4. G.S. 115C-238.66 is amended by adding a new subdivision to read:
9 "(11a) Instructional materials. – The board of directors shall ensure that information
10 about instructional materials is prominently displayed on the website of the
11 regional school, in accordance with G.S. 115C-98A."
12 SECTION 5 G.S. 115C-218.85 is amended by adding a new subsection to read:
13 "(c) Instructional Materials. – A charter school shall ensure that information about
14 instructional materials is prominently displayed on the website of the regional school, in
15 accordance with G.S. 115C-98A."

31 SECTION 7. Except as otherwise provided, this act is effective when it becomes law
32 and applies beginning with the display of instructional materials used during the 2021-2022
33 school year.
